* Re: Is there a replacement for \tracechinesetrue in mkiv? 2011-12-29 14:18 ` Hans Hagen @ 2011-12-30 15:52 ` Zhichu Chen 0 siblings, 0 replies; 7+ messages in thread From: Zhichu Chen @ 2011-12-30 15:52 UTC (permalink / raw) To: Hans Hagen; +Cc: mailing list for ConTeXt users Well, that's just perfect, only it's not what I'm looking for :( What I need is a fully customable way to debug some of my inputs rather than everything as a font feature. I found a "cleaner" way now: to use the "whatsit" node, I hope it's useful for someone so I paste the function here: ============================================ local function trace_boundingbox (head) for n in node.traverse (head) do if n.id == node.id ('glyph') then local ht,wd,dp = n.height,n.width,n.depth local htsp,wdsp,dpsp = ht/65536,wd/65536,dp/65536 local w = node.new("whatsit","pdf_literal") w.data = "q 1 0 1 RG 1 0 1 rg 0.1 w 0 " .. -dpsp .. " m 0 " .. htsp .. " l " .. -wdsp .. " " .. htsp .. " l " .. -wdsp .. " " .. -dpsp .. " l s 0 1 0 RG 0 1 0 rg 0.1 w [2 1] 0 d 0 0 m " .. -wdsp .. " 0 l S Q" node.insert_after (head, n, w) end end end ============================================ On Thu, Dec 29, 2011 at 10:18 PM, Hans Hagen <pragma@wxs.nl> wrote: > On 29-12-2011 04:22, Zhichu Chen wrote: >> >> All right, after some readings, I came out with a node solution.
